STOLEN DINGHY and Marshall Islands Visa Renewals! EP74 This week we being the somewhat lengthy procedure to renew our Marshall Islands visas. Due to Covid 19, we can't safely get back to NZ, so we have to apply for a one year visitor visa. We spend a lot of time at the local hospital, getting medical checks done and finally manage to complete all of the paperwork only to be thwarted by immigration... Then there's a drama in the anchorage as we apprehend a dinghy thief after a high speed chase.... We are Jo and Rob and we are here to share our sailing adventures with you. In 2016, inspired by the likes of ‘Delos’, ‘Sailing La Vagabonde’ and ‘Gone with The Wynns’, we sold up everything we owned and bought our 40ft, Fountaine Pajot ‘Lipari 41 Evo’ sailing catamaran ‘Double Trouble’. We had no sailing experience whatsoever, so the past few years have been a huge learning curve. We thought it might be fun to document our travels for anyone thinking of following a similar lifestyle. So far we have visited 7 different countries and sailed over 13,000 nautical miles. We have had many unique experiences that would not have been possible in our prior life and we don’t regret a second. We're both super keen on protecting our precious environment, so amongst other things, we both follow a plant based diet. You wont find any fishing footage on this channel!
